Full job description

We are looking for an experienced construction NVQ assessor to join our team. You will work closely with our senior IQAs and assessors to ensure the company’s high standards are always maintained. You will be able to assess a range of NVQs. It would also be advantageous for you to have an IQA qualification.

We are looking for assessors with the following competencies & experience of assessing:

Site Management (Level 6 - 7)

Various Trade NVQs (Level 2 - 3)

All our portfolios are online e-portfolios (Quals Direct) therefore you need to be able to work remotely and have a strong understanding of how e-portfolio systems work.

You will also be expected to visit candidates on site. (Expenses will be paid and a car allowance considered if regular travel is undertaken.)

In addition to your role as an Assessor, there is a clear pathway to up-skill and progress into a Tutor role, delivering training across a variety of qualifications. You must therefore be open and willing to take on this professional development opportunity.

The company has grown rapidly in the last few years. Our success is due in part to our commitment to effective and concise communications and prompt response to enquiries. The successful candidate must always be prepared to strive to replicate and achieve these qualities.

Qualifications Required

  • Holder of assessor/verifier qualifications such as
  • A1/A2, V1/V2 or
  • D32/33/34 or
  • You will require one of the following qualifications
  • Level 3 Award in Assessing Competence in the Work Environment
  • Level 3 Award in Assessing Vocationally Related Achievement
  • Relevant Level 2 or 3 Trade NVQ e.g. Level 2 NVQ in Site Carpentry.
  • Level 6 Construction Site Management NVQ Or Level 7 Senior Construction Management NVQ Or Level 6 Occupational Health & Safety NVQ.
  • Experience: You must have Construction Industry experience, ideally with experience in Construction Site Supervision / Management
